When software is "patched" to bypass a license key, it means that someone has modified the software to remove or circumvent the need for a valid license key. This can provide users with access to the full features of the software without paying for it. However, it's crucial to understand the implications:
Crack distribution sites are notorious vectors for malware. The file you download might successfully color your folders, but it can silently install a Trojan horse in the background. Most "patches" or "keygens" are Trojan horses. Once executed, they install malware quietly in the background. Your antivirus might flag it, but sketchy sites often tell you to "disable antivirus before installing." Disabling your protection gives attackers full access to your operating system. 2.
